One great tradion in curling is "BROOMSTACKING". This term refers to the social get-together after each game. Originally, curlers, after completing a curling game on the pond, would stack their brooms in front of the fire and enjoy beverages with the opponent. This tradition is still alive today and it is expected that you partake in BROOMSTACKING after every game!
